STINGRAY consists of a microfluidic chip, a manifold chip holder, and a versatile automatic device to operate the microfluidic chip. The entire system can be modified by adjusting the number of parts and parameters according to the individual requirements of a customer. This can reduce the final cost. The core of the microfluidic system is a PMMA-based chip with six independent inputs. All inputs can be used for specific purposes.
It is designed for microfluidic processes such as gentle mixing, separation, extraction, nanoparticle formation, etc. The platform offers a range of connections for various microfluidic processes.
